Famine in Far-Go is supposed to add (among others) Shapeshifter and Wheeled, a combination that brought transformers to my mind right away. I'm presuming from the new set that AI, Wheeled, and Plastic are all supposed to be artificial options to have alongside the existing Android which should allow a lot more robot and cyborg style characters.

As far as expansions, I'd love them do some simple rules to cover huge scale battles: Massive armies of mutants or robots fighting eachother over ancient bases and the remaining settlements, and working together against the occasional titanic mutant monster. There was the old Battlesystem for AD&D (which was just to much like a full miniature wargame) and the War Machine rules from the original D&D Companion Set (which was just to much like a battle against an aggressive math problem). Something in between that is GW style vibrant ("Send in the borrowers." "Sir, the Hoop mercenaries are demanding more carrots again." "Oops, that unit just turned into radioactive goo..." could be awesome.)

I would also like to see some more Omega Tech categories then Area 52, Ishtar, and Xi. Maybe like Tesla (goofy 50s pulp style gadgets like shrink rays and leftovers from his robot army), Gamma Knight (individual pieces of hyper advanced power armor suits), and one that is all about organic equipment that joins to and feeds on the wielder to fuel its power.

Deftects - mutations that are flat-out bad - or rules to treat any Alpha card as a 'defect.'  Alternate deck-building rules that require defects - if you want to include rares, say.

A dedicated monster book, or DM box set that includes same (plus maps, counters, etc).

Options to have origins or classes that work more like D&D classes - learned skills and professions rather than mutant origins. 

A box set for more serious play.  Maybe "Gamma World: Survivors."  Could include alternate apocalypse scenarios, Pure-Strain-Human origins, more 21st century tech, and more sinister/brutal futuristic tech.  Grittier, more detailed rules on weapons & ammo, wounds, healing (surges?), economics, survival, etc...

Box sets that are at least 11" along one dimension, so you can store standard-sized paper in them (like plain paper copies of the character sheets, printouts, and, oh, the Freesboro module).

Worldines.  Cyberpunk Xi, science-fantasy/atlanitean Ishtar, Tesla's robot empire, etc...

More cards.  For instance, each expansion could include an 80-card DM deck that reprints the Commmon and Uncommon cards from the prior booster set.

Its a long list

Feats. I was thinking I could homebrew these as an alternative to being able to use alpha mutations, which I think, as a concept are too silly. This trading card thing leaves a bad taste in my mouth though Omega Tech is alright. I like feats because as it stands now, the randomness makes people less attatched to their characters and I would rather run a more stable game where PCs have a more DnD like survival rate.

More Monsters! We don't even have monsters between 7-9. And the gamma world book doesn't give any advice on making custom monsters and traps. Yeah you could use DnD but Gamma World is supposed to be stand alone. Which leads me to...

Guidelines for making NPCs. I guess I could stat them up like players but how do I determine their role?

As much as I am disappointed by the lack of a paragon tier, a higher priority is making sure I have a complete game for the heroic tier and this game seems to lack even that.

Backgrounds like in DnD! I think these encourage more roleplaying and also encourage players to value their characters more.

Healing Surges and Second Wind! Maybe we can use nature for heal checks on humans and mutants and mechanics for heal checks on androids.

Vehicle rules and stats. If we run a combat now, there is not telling how many squares a truck can move.

Less randomness in character creation. Why is skill training a d10 roll? Why can't players pick?

An official GM screen. I love my GM screen as I love putting stickers everytime I kill a player.

Equipment rules for buying things, maybe with bottle caps like in fallout.

I think we want different games.  In practice, the random character creation system encouraged a lot of roleplaying in our group.., a lot more than the DnD backgrounds did on thier own in our group.  As for us, we enjoy the random character generation and yes it has encouraged a lot of roleplaying.  I think the majority of the players in our group are Min/ maxers at heart, random character creation gets them out of the number crunching rut, and more into the role playing.


You can also choose to pick your skill and origins if you wish.  Don't be hung up on the rules, play the game the way you wish.   Take this advice from an old school role player, rules should always be a guideline in reaching the fun in playing, if the rules aren' t fun for you, change them, it's OK.

I think all you requests are valid ones, but I am glad for one, that they did not make Gamma World a DnD 4e clone.  The new Gamma World is similar enough to 4e, that making the transition is easy especially running combat, but a complete clone would have been boring to me.
